SMITHERS, W.Va. (WSAZ) -- A police chief is facing charges after an alleged confrontation with a man in a grocery store parking lot. Cedar Grove Police Chief Aaron Roop, 31, has been charged with misdemeanor assault and misdemeanor brandishing.
